The Yamaha GO44 is a mobile audio solution that features high quality line
inputs/outputs and worldclass MIDI and audio recording software enabling
professional quality recording to a computer in a very compact package that
can be carried and used virtually anyway.
The Yamaha GO44 boasts up to 24-bit/192kHz resolution on the analog inputs/
outputs – the best in its class – and 24-bit/96kHz on the digital I/O. This pro-level
quality makes the Yamaha GO44 perfect for any type of recording, and allows
you to capture the full details and nuances of the original source – from the
breathiness of a vocal to the delicate finger slides of an acoustic guitar performance.

The Yamaha GO44 features 4-in/4-out multi-channel audio, with two analog phone
jack terminals for both input and output, and special S/P DIF coaxial terminals for
two-channel digital in/out. This device is simple and easy to use, yet provides high-quality
recording capability – perfect not only for those who want to create music, but also
for those who want an audio playback system for their computer that delivers
outstanding sound quality.

The digital outputs on the Yamaha GO44 are compatible with the AC-3 and DTS
surround sound formats. Simply connect a surround compatible amplifier/speaker
setup, and enjoy the powerful sonic experience of surround sound.

Yamaha GO44 Features:
FireWire audio interface
Durable aluminum die cast body
Simple, small and light weight
2 x Balanced Line inputs / outputs
Headphones output on Front Panel
1 MIDI In /1 MIDI Out
S/P DIF In/Out up to 24 bit/96 kHz
24 Bit/192 kHz compatible

The 828mk3 is MOTU's most advanced FireWire audio interface. Once again it raises the bar with innovative new features, enhanced standard features that remain unique, superb sound and reliable performance.

The 828mk3 provides ten channels of pristine 192 kHz analog recording and playback, combined with sixteen channels of ADAT digital I/O and stereo S/PDIF. Expand your system by connecting additional MOTU FireWire audio interfaces or the 8pre mic input expander.

The 828mk3 is equally well-suited for studio and stage, with or without a computer. As an interface or standalone mixer, the 828mk3 provides 28 separate inputs and 30 separate outputs, including dedicated main outs on XLRs and two front panel headphone outs.

Connect all of your studio gear, including microphones, guitars, synths, keyboards, drum machines and even effects processors. Record, monitor, route and process all of these live inputs using the professional on-board CueMix FX digital mixer – with no latency and no processor strain on your computer. Apply hardware DSP-driven compression, EQ and reverb to every input and output, independent of your host computer. When recording from the mic/guitar inputs, the 828mk3ʼs signal overload protection gives you an extra 12 dB of headroom above zero with no digital clipping or harsh artifacts.

MOTU FireWire audio interfaces are fully compatible with FireWire 800-equipped Macs. All you need is a standard FireWire 400-to-800 cable. Just plug in and go. The FireWire bus operates at 400 Mb/sec, providing the same high speed, low latency and rock solid reliability that MOTU FireWire interfaces are known for.

After programming the on-board mixing in the studio, unplug the 828mk3 from the computer and take it on the road for operation as a stand-alone mixer with effects. All mixing and effects parameters are adjustable using the front panel backlit LCD.

The 828mk3 provides cross-platform compatibility with Mac and Windows and all of your favorite audio software and host-based effects via WDM/ASIO/Core Audio drivers. Or you can use the included AudioDesk workstation software for Mac, with 24-bit recording/editing and 32-bit mixing/processing/mastering.

he U46XL is a powerful multi-purpose 4-in 6-out multi-channel audio interface designed for various recording applications at home or on the road. The U46XL is the successor of to ESI Audio's famous U46DJ interface.

As its predecessor, it provides 2 stereo line inputs, a microphone input with +48V phantom power and a headphone output. A main difference is the improved analog circuitry improving the audio quality as well as the professional microphone preamplifier with XLR input. This makes the U46XL the perfect solution to record signals from dynamic or condenser microphones on the road or in your studio.

The unit also features an instrument input (Hi-Z), typically to connect a guitar directly to it. Two totally separate stereo line input on the backside provide 4 simultaneously usable input channels at one time. There are also 6 independent individual outputs on the backside, perfect for multi-channel playback applications like to provide individual outputs for software synthesizers, to provide independent playback channels for DJ software or to provide surround playback capability via a 5.1 setup. A separate mix output with professional TRS outputs could be used to connect U46XL to professional stereo studio monitors.

A cool feature is the DirectWIRE support in the driver, allowing you to record signals from one application to another internally. U46XL works with this driver based on our EWDM technology under Windows XP and Windows Vista/7, however U46XL is also Mac OS X compatible.

U46XL ships with Cubase LE 4 from Steinberg for Mac and PC to start recording on a professional level right out of the box.

    The all new 896mk3 FireWire audio interface delivers high-end performance, superb sound, innovative new features and enhanced standard features that remain unique.

    The 896mk3 provides eight channels of pristine 24-bit 192 kHz analog recording and playback, combined with sixteen channels of optical digital I/O, stereo AES/EBU, S/PDIF and separate analog main outs. Expand your system by connecting the 8pre mic input expander or other MOTU audio interfaces.

    The 896mk3 is equally well-suited for studio and stage, with or without a computer. As an interface or standalone mixer, the 896mk3 provides 28 separate inputs and 32 separate outputs, including dedicated main outs on XLRs and two front panel headphone outs.

    Connect all of your studio gear, including microphones, guitars, synths, keyboards, drum machines and even effects processors. Record, monitor, route and process all of these live inputs using the professional on-board CueMix FX digital mixer – with no latency and no processor strain on your computer. Apply hardware DSP-driven effects processing to inputs, outputs, and busses independent of your host computer. Add Classic Reverb™ with lengths up to 60 seconds. Further sculpt your sound with 7-band parametric EQ featuring filter types carefully modeled after British analog console EQs. Choose between two forms of compression: a conventional compressor and the Leveler™, an accurate model of the legendary LA-2A™ optical compressor that provides vintage, musical automatic gain control.

    MOTU FireWire audio interfaces are fully compatible with FireWire 800-equipped Macs. All you need is a standard FireWire 400-to-800 cable. Just plug in and go. The FireWire bus operates at 400 Mb/sec, providing the same high speed, low latency and rock solid reliability that MOTU FireWire interfaces are known for.

    When recording from the mic/guitar inputs, the 896mk3ʼs signal overload protection gives you an extra 12 dB of headroom above zero with no clipping or harsh artifacts.

    After programming the on-board mixing in the studio, unplug the 896mk3 from the computer and take it on the road for operation as a stand-alone mixer with effects. All mixing and effects parameters are adjustable using the front panel backlit LCD.

    The 896mk3 provides cross-platform compatibility with Mac and Windows and all of your favorite audio software and host-based effects via WDM/ASIO/Core Audio drivers. Or you can use the included AudioDesk workstation software for Mac, with 24-bit recording/editing and 32-bit mixing/processing/mastering.
